Megan Thee Stallion fought back tears as she addressed the crowd, expressing the realization that she needed therapy.
Megan has captivated audiences with her unmatched confidence and vibrant stage presence. However, during a recent event at Philadelphia’s Wells Fargo Center, the Grammy-winning artist opened up about her personal struggles, revealing a heartfelt side of her mental health journey.
She described her breaking point as a subtle shift rather than a significant crisis; it was a feeling of overwhelming sadness that she could no longer ignore. “I didn’t know that I needed to go to therapy until one day I was just like, oh damn, I am so sad… It’s really terrifying that I am so sad,” she confessed, taking a moment to wipe away her tears.
This heartfelt revelation resonated deeply with many fans who have witnessed her journey through hardships, success, and scrutiny. Megan’s honesty served as a reminder that even those who appear strong and composed can also seek help.
Megan Thee Stallion also shared that during her lowest moments, she felt indifferent about her life, a clear signal that she required support. “It was really scary,” she reflected. “I didn’t want to feel like that, like, I should care about my life.”
Taraji P. Henson, a long-time advocate for mental health awareness, expressed gratitude towards Megan for her openness. “Somebody out there is feeling exactly how you feel,” she noted, emphasizing the power of vulnerability.
